The African country of Mozambique has been undertaking a remarkable development process within the past. However this could not be translated into significantly decreasing poverty– or unemployment rates. Due to a high population growth and large amounts of jobseekers every year the economy is not able to create a corresponding number of jobs. Especially amongst young the unemployment remains high. Moreover there seems to be a crucial mismatch between the demand of the labour market and the knowledge provided by the education sector. This work is based on a qualitative field study carried out in Ribáuè a district located in Nampula province in the northern part of Mozambique. It wants to shed further light on employment possibilities young people have and aims on fostering a vast image of their situation by examining sectors such as education agriculture and politics.
